Understanding Hyaluronic Acid and Its Role in Makeup
Hyaluronic acid may sound technical, but it is actually a naturally occurring substance within the skin that plays a vital role in maintaining hydration. What makes it so remarkable is its ability to hold up to 1,000 times its weight in water. This powerful moisture-binding property helps keep skin plump, smooth, and refreshed. When included in makeup products, hyaluronic acid transforms ordinary cosmetics into multitasking formulas that both enhance appearance and improve skin hydration.
Why Hyaluronic Acid Benefits the Skin
Hyaluronic acid works like a hydration magnet for the skin. Its molecular structure attracts water from the environment and holds it within the skin’s surface layers. This hydration boost creates a subtle plumping effect that softens the look of fine lines and gives skin a healthy, bouncy texture. When incorporated into makeup formulas, it allows your complexion to remain hydrated while still providing the coverage and finish you want.

Choosing Hydrating Makeup Based on Your Skin Type
Selecting the right hydrating makeup depends largely on your individual skin type. While hyaluronic acid provides moisture, other ingredients in the formula determine how well the product performs for different skin concerns.
Makeup for Dry Skin
Those with dry skin benefit from formulas that combine hyaluronic acid with additional nourishing ingredients. Components such as ceramides, glycerin, and natural oils strengthen the skin barrier and help retain moisture throughout the day. Avoid overly matte or extremely long-wear formulas, as they may reduce hydration and emphasize dry areas.
Best Hydrating Makeup for Oily Skin
Oily skin often experiences dehydration even when it produces excess oil. Lightweight, water-based makeup enriched with hyaluronic acid can help restore moisture balance without clogging pores. These breathable formulas hydrate the skin while helping regulate oil production over time.
Makeup Considerations for Sensitive and Mature Skin
Sensitive skin requires gentle products that avoid harsh fragrances and potential irritants. Mature skin, on the other hand, benefits greatly from the plumping properties of hyaluronic acid. These formulas can soften the appearance of fine lines while delivering natural-looking coverage that enhances the skin rather than settling into wrinkles.
Important Ingredients in Hydrating Makeup
Although hyaluronic acid is a standout ingredient, the most effective hydrating makeup products often include additional supportive components. These ingredients work together to maintain moisture levels and improve the overall health of the skin.
Complementary Moisturising Ingredients
Ceramides help strengthen the skin barrier and prevent moisture loss, while glycerin acts as a humectant that draws hydration into the skin. Peptides may offer anti-ageing support, and vitamin E provides antioxidant protection. Natural oils such as jojoba or squalane can add nourishment while keeping the formula lightweight.
Ingredients to Avoid in Makeup
Some ingredients may counteract the benefits of hydrating makeup. Denatured alcohol can dry the skin, and heavy fragrances may trigger irritation for sensitive complexions. Individuals prone to breakouts should also be cautious of comedogenic oils that may clog pores and lead to congestion.
Applying Hyaluronic Acid Makeup for a Radiant Finish
Even the best hydrating makeup requires the right application technique. Proper preparation and layering help maximise the benefits of these products and create a natural, glowing finish.
Preparing the Skin
Begin with well-hydrated skin by applying a hyaluronic acid serum to slightly damp skin. Follow with a lightweight moisturiser to seal in hydration. A hydrating primer can then create a smooth base that allows foundation to blend effortlessly.
Application Techniques for Best Results
Applying foundation in thin layers helps achieve a natural finish. Using a damp beauty sponge or a dense brush allows the product to blend seamlessly into the skin. Rather than dragging the product across the face, gently pressing it into the skin helps maintain hydration while improving coverage.
Creating a Natural Dewy Look
To enhance a luminous finish, cream highlighters can be applied to the high points of the face before lightly setting the makeup. Instead of heavy powder, a hydrating setting spray can lock in the look while maintaining the skin’s glow. If powder is needed, applying it only to the T-zone helps preserve the natural radiance of the skin.
Things to Consider When Buying Hyaluronic Acid Makeup
With many hydrating makeup products available, understanding how to evaluate them can make the shopping process easier and more effective.
Reading Ingredient Labels
For the best results, hyaluronic acid should appear near the top of the ingredient list. Products that list it among the first few ingredients usually contain a meaningful concentration. Some formulas also include different molecular weights of hyaluronic acid, allowing both surface hydration and deeper moisture support.

Is hyaluronic acid beneficial in makeup products?
Yes, hyaluronic acid helps maintain hydration throughout the day while makeup is worn. This can reduce dryness, smooth fine lines, and support a healthy, radiant complexion.
Are there ingredients that should not be combined with hyaluronic acid?
Hyaluronic acid generally works well with most ingredients. However, using strong exfoliating acids in the same routine may reduce its effectiveness if not balanced properly. Applying hyaluronic acid to slightly damp skin helps maximise hydration.
Can makeup containing hyaluronic acid cause breakouts?
Hyaluronic acid itself is non-comedogenic and unlikely to clog pores. Breakouts are more likely to result from other ingredients in the formula, so reviewing the full ingredient list and patch testing new products is recommended.
How long does hydrating makeup typically last?
Well-formulated hydrating makeup can remain effective for eight to twelve hours. In many cases, the finish improves as the day progresses because the hyaluronic acid continues attracting moisture to the skin.
